I applied via Campus Placement and was interviewed before Jun 2023. There were 3 interview rounds.

Round 1 - Coding Test 

A few coding question split in two sections, they were time consuming but simple enough for average student

Round 2 - One-on-one 

(4 Questions)

  • Q1. Brief and Crisp Introduction.
  • Q2. Resume related question on skills
  • Q3. Project related question.
  • Q4. Detailed and brief working of a few of my projects

I applied via Campus Placement and was interviewed in Apr 2023. There were 4 interview rounds.

Round 1 - Resume Shortlist 
Pro Tip by AmbitionBox:
Keep your resume crisp and to the point. A recruiter looks at your resume for an average of 6 seconds, make sure to leave the best impression.
View all tips
Round 2 - Aptitude Test 

It was logical reasoning and numerical. There is no coding, overall relatively simple.

Round 3 - Group Discussion 

We had GD in a group of 10, and we had been given 15 mins for the entire round. Make sure you speak and are confident. This round was also easy

Round 4 - Technical 

(2 Questions)

  • Q1. SCR, High pass low pass filters, Computer network basics.
  • Q2. Fibonnacci sequence code

Interview Preparation Tips

Topics to prepare for Alstom Transportation Graduate Trainee interview:
  • Electronics
Interview preparation tips for other job seekers - Technical was the toughest round. Please prepare your branch basics from 2 and 3 years.
